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 98122

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en 98122?

Actualmente hay 678 Apartamentos Estudios en 98122 con alquileres que van desde $750 hasta $3,513, con un precio medio de $1,677.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en 98122?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en 98122 varian entre $625 y $4,935 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,278

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en 98122?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en 98122 van desde $1,017 hasta $16,025.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,481

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 98122?

En estos momentos hay 95 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en 98122 en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,175 y $11,895 - con una media de $5,113 para el lugar.
